Last year, ADEY supplied British Gas national installation engineers with the company’s MagnaClean PowerFlushing Filter to enhance the traditional power-flushing process to remove sludge trapped in the system. ADEY Professional Heating Solutions has secured another major contract with British Gas.

This latest development is seen as a natural progression, introducing industry ‘best practice’ to all installation and service engineers working for British Gas. The Cheltenham-based manufacturer will supply the Installation and Service Divisions of British Gas with its MagnaClean Professional technology which removes virtually 100% of suspended black iron oxide from central heating systems.

As part of the deal, ADEY will exclusively supply its 22mm and 28mm magnetic filters which will form part of a new standard installation policy for British Gas engineers operating throughout the UK.

ADEY’s National Account Director Phil Sadler believes the decision by British Gas to adopt the new policy is excellent news all round bringing with it benefits to the energy provider, its engineers out in the field, customers and the environment.

“This technology is proven and is becoming accepted best practice in the industry. The introduction of MagnaClean Professional to every installation will provide ongoing protection for new central heating systems which, as a result, will have fewer maintenance issues and will go on working for far longer in the future,” he says.

“More importantly, it will also mean more satisfied customers which is a key consideration. Customers can actually see for themselves how effective MagnaClean Professional is when the filter is serviced reassuring them and giving peace of mind,” he adds.

Another benefit of the MagnaClean magnetic filter technology is its environmental contribution in helping reduce household carbon emissions which ties in well with ADEY’s own carbon neutral company status.

“If MagnaClean Professional is fitted to every domestic central heating system in the country, the overall impact will be significant. Systems will be far more effective and perform much more closely to optimum levels, which in turn would contribute to a reduction in carbon emissions in every household,” highlights Phil Sadler.
